“Unearthing the Literary Archives of Russia’s Brontë Sisters: The Poetry of Nadezhda Khvoshchinskaya” will scan, transcribe and publish digitally about 200 poems, with translations into English of selected poems, by Nadezhda Khvoshchinskaya (1821-89), located in two notebooks in the Russian State Archive of Literature and Art in Moscow. They are the last major missing part of an ongoing project with an international team of scholars, archivists, and translators that began in collaboration with Arja Rosenholm in 2000, which will make the large oeuvre and story of this major nineteenth-century Russian woman writer accessible in the digital age to readers, students, scholars, and translators and to rebuild her reputation.
